Why HDMI to USB-C Adapter for Monitor Is Necessary
I found that an HDMI to USB-C adapter becomes necessary when I want to connect devices that don’t naturally match the ports on my monitor. A lot of modern monitors and laptops use USB-C for video input, while many older laptops, desktops, and gaming devices still only have HDMI output. In my experience, the adapter makes it possible to bridge that gap without replacing perfectly good equipment.

My Buying Guides on Hdmi To Usb C Adapter For Monitor
What I Look For First
When I shop for an HDMI to USB-C adapter for a monitor, the first thing I check is whether it supports the exact connection I need. I make sure my device can actually send video through USB-C, because not every USB-C port does. I also confirm that the adapter is meant for display output and not just charging or data transfer.
Compatibility With My Devices
I always look at compatibility before buying. Some adapters work only with laptops, while others also support tablets or phones. I check whether my monitor, laptop, and adapter all support the same standards. If my device uses USB-C with DisplayPort Alt Mode, I know I have a better chance of getting a smooth setup.
Video Resolution and Refresh Rate
I pay close attention to resolution and refresh rate because they affect how sharp and smooth the display looks. If I want a 1080p monitor, most adapters are fine. But if I use a 4K monitor, I look for an adapter that supports 4K at 60Hz for better clarity and motion. For gaming or fast work, I prefer higher refresh rates whenever possible.
Build Quality and Cable Design
I like adapters that feel sturdy and well-made. A solid aluminum case, reinforced connectors, and a reliable cable make a big difference in daily use. If I travel often, I choose a compact adapter that fits easily in my bag and does not feel fragile.
Power Delivery Support
If I want to charge my laptop while using the adapter, I look for one with USB-C power delivery pass-through. This feature helps me keep my device powered without giving up the display connection. I also check the wattage so I know it can support my charger properly.
Audio and Extra Features
Some adapters carry video only, while others also support audio through the HDMI connection. I prefer one that includes audio if I plan to use external speakers or my monitor’s built-in speakers. Extra USB ports or Ethernet can also be useful if I want a more complete hub.
